A homicide investigation is underway after an unresponsive woman was found with severe injuries in Bridgeport on Tuesday night and later died and police said they found a child alone nearby.

Officers originally responded to the 200 block of Black Rock Avenue around 9:30 p.m. for a report of an abandoned child on the front porch of a home. There, they said they found the child and then found the woman injured on the street nearby.

Police said the woman, later identified as 24-year-old Evelyn Rayo-Mairena, of Bridgeport, was lying on the street and was unresponsive.
